Overview of Water Resources

Groundwater, 顾名思义, is water resources stored beneath the surface. The Earth has abundant water resources, but the amount of water that can be directly used for irrigation is not as much as people imagine.

Most of the Earth’s freshwater resources are distributed in mountain glaciers and other hard-to-access areas. Although there is a large amount of seawater, it cannot be directly used. The relatively accessible river water, 湖水, and surface water account for only about 0.387% of the world’s total freshwater resources, and their distribution is uneven, making them unavailable in many regions.

然而, you may not realize that underground freshwater resources account for nearly 30% of the world’s total freshwater resources, which is dozens of times more than surface water. 此外, groundwater is distributed very evenly. In many dry areas lacking surface water, groundwater is almost the only source of freshwater. 在农业灌溉中, groundwater is also a very important source of freshwater.

所以, it can be said that if groundwater cannot be properly utilized, it would truly be a great waste of resources!

Advantages of Groundwater

We already know that groundwater is very important in the field of agricultural irrigation. So what advantages does it have? 下一个, let us list them one by one.

Large Reserves

The first thing that should be mentioned is the most obvious advantage of groundwater: its reserves are very large. As we mentioned in the figures above, you should know that its reserves are far greater than surface water. 当然, it should be noted that all the water mentioned in this article refers to freshwater. Seawater, which cannot be directly used, is not included in the discussion.

Wide Distribution

Groundwater exists almost everywhere. Many places have very harsh climates, such as drought, little rainfall, or a lack of rivers. Although surface water cannot be utilized in these places, groundwater can still be effectively used.

Strong Drought Resistance

Groundwater is deeply stored underground, so it is not easily affected by climate conditions. 例如, surface water may dry up under continuous high temperatures and strong sunlight. 然而, groundwater does not have this problem. No matter how the weather and climate change on the surface, the supply of groundwater can remain stable.

Flood Prevention Effect

Groundwater can not only prevent drought but also help prevent flooding. 一般来说, using groundwater for irrigation requires the construction of wells. These wells can not only provide water resources for agricultural irrigation areas but also help regulate the water level. During the rainy season, crops are less likely to be flooded.

Saving Land Resources

传统灌溉方法, such as canal irrigation, require the construction of channels, which occupy a certain amount of land resources. 然而, if groundwater is introduced through wells for irrigation, it does not take up much land, greatly saving land resources. 此外, later maintenance is also very convenient. This method not only saves land but also reduces labor and other costs.

Improving Irrigation Efficiency

Traditional canal irrigation requires transporting water over long distances to irrigation areas. During this process, a certain amount of water resources will be lost due to evaporation, leakage, 和其他因素. 然而, if groundwater well irrigation is used, these losses can be avoided, and the water delivery time can also be greatly reduced. 因此, irrigation efficiency is improved.

The above are the six advantages of groundwater. If combined with modern water-saving irrigation technologies such as sprinkler irrigation and drip irrigation, the irrigation effect and efficiency can be significantly improved. This has already become a very popular irrigation method today.
